Excellent, classic Coney joint.
Prices have gone up, but still pretty fair for the size of the portions.
If you get there between 11am and 3pm, the lunch specials are the ticket.
Chicken Gumbo Soup – thick and spicy.
German Tomato Soup – like maybe a stuffed cabbage soup. Excellent!
French Onion Soup – salty and delicious.
Gyro – not as good as the “cut from the log” ones, but it’s the next best thing.
Big Breakfast – Bacon is always great, hotcakes are just right. They can make Over Hard eggs, and they are actually Over Hard.
Biscuits and Gravy – really filling, you might want the 1/2 order.
Coffee – pretty strong “diner coffee”, excellent.
2% surcharge on cards.
Highly Recommend
